Responsibilities

  • Manage assigned customer accounts, including Taylor Companies and external wholesale accounts
  • Coordinate and communicate multiple complex elements of account programs to meet customer requirements and expectations
  • Serve as a backup to peers by supporting their accounts as needed
  • Ensure customer requests and expectations are met by answering questions regarding program plans, stock, orders, pricing, and inquiries - primarily via email
  • Process customer purchase orders accurately and on time by tracking orders through departments and systems
  • Demonstrate product knowledge by clearly explaining features and benefits
  • Provide continuous updates on procedures and guidelines in the area
  • Anticipate customer needs and issues, proactively communicating program requirements, production timelines, shipping details, payment, and pricing information
  • Resolve service issues politely, efficiently, and professionally
  • Partner with departments (including sales) to support customer needs and requests, such as establishing critical dates, quotes, production timelines, inventory levels, and shipping options
